Observational tests of a two parameter power-law class modified gravity in Palatini formalism

Cosmology and Nongalactic Astrophysics 2009-11-06 v2

Abstract

{\bf{CONTEXT}}: In this work we propose a modified gravity action f(R)=(RnR0n)1/nf(R)=(R^n-R^n_{0})^{1/n} with two free parameters of nn and R0R_{0} and derive the dynamics of a universe for this action in the Palatini formalism. {\bf {AIM}}: We do a cosmological comparison of this model with observed data to find the best parameters of a model in a flat universe. {\bf{METHOD}}: To constrain the free parameters of model we use SNIa type Ia data in two sets of gold and union samples, CMB-shift parameter, baryon acoustic oscillation, gas mass fraction in cluster of galaxies, and large-scale structure data. {\bf {RESULT}}: The best fit from the observational data results in the parameters of model in the range of n=0.980.08+0.08n=0.98^{+0.08}_{-0.08} and ΩM=0.25+0.10.1\Omega_M = 0.25_{+0.1}^{-0.1} with one sigma level of confidence where a standard Λ\LambdaCDM universe resides in this range of solution.
